This testimonial will certainly concentrate on evidence for the application of the very first 3 techniques when areas are inhabited. Of these methods, upper-room UVGI has been made use of for greater than 70 years to reduce transmission of microorganisms such as tuberculosis (TB). The studies in this review cover various UVGI technologies that can be used in spaces with people present, consisting of UV-C lights that are wall-mounted, UV-C ceiling fans, and portable UV-C air cleaners.
Nine research studies were consisted of, nine reporting on the effectiveness (See Proof Table 1-3) and two reporting on the safety and security (Table 4) of UVGI technologies to minimize SARS-CoV-2 airborne of occupied spaces. The evidence was from simulation (n=8) and empirical (n=1) research studies and general the degree of proof in this evaluation is considered reduced.
Both the wall surface placed and ceiling fan components have disinfecting UV-C lamps that intend up at the ceiling. These modern technologies were reliable in reducing SARS-CoV-2 in the air of occupied spaces in both observational (n=1) and simulation (n=6) research studies. A Russian hospital reported only neighborhood acquired COVID-19 instances among personnel April to June 2020 and no transmission among individuals to team in health center spaces with wall-mounted top area UVGI fixtures (low-pressure mercury lamps, 254 nm).

This included an area investigation and a simulation research study. High level points are listed below and information on individual research studies can be found in Table 4. An area examination from Russia reported that upper room UVGI low-pressure mercury lamps (254 nm, 30 W) used 1 day a day, 7 days a week, in busy hospital areas were risk-free.
The higher the UVGI light is located on the wall, the lower the danger of over-exposure. you can check here If the ceiling elevation is 2.74 m, a UVGI light installing elevation of 2.29 m leads to a lowered degree of UV-C radiation reflected into the reduced zone of the room, compared to a placing height of 2.13 m.
When both UVGI lights were situated on one long wall surface of the area, it caused the lowest threat of overexposure.
